Original Query: Does anyone know if there is anywhere you can go to check what the weather was on the date you were born? A teacher at my school is asking ... Thanks to all who responded. I checked out each response...I don't think they kept too many records before the 1970's because that's all the data I could find. I was also asked to post a hit from several people and here it is: Try this: http://www.almanac.com/weatherhistory/locations/FL.php To change to other states, just change the state abbreviation, leaving the .php at the end of the URL If you try to go into the site from the front end, the Farmer's Almanac home page, it requires that you register. However, you can work around it by going straight to the above URL. Cindy ***** http://www.crh.noaa.gov/iwx/program_areas/wxhisttdy/calendar.php <http://www.crh.noaa.gov/iwx/program_areas/wxhisttdy/calendar.php> This might help. ***** This only works for the years 1970 through the present. Go to Weather Underground: http://www.weatherunderground.com/ <http://www.weatherunderground.com/> Type in the zipcode that you want the weather from. Once that page has loaded, scroll down to the box labeled: History/Almanac Select the date you want and hit enter. Voila!
